Living in Atlanta, GA

Atlanta's transport infrastructure includes a network of highways, such as the I-285 perimeter and the I-75/I-85 connector, which facilitate commuting and regional travel. Public transit options are available, with a metro system and bus services providing connectivity across the city. The area's walkability varies, with pedestrian-friendly neighborhoods offering sidewalks and bike lanes. Recent initiatives aim to enhance transport efficiency and accessibility, reflecting the city's commitment to improving mobility for all residents.

The community benefits from a robust educational system, with numerous public and private schools, higher education institutions, and specialized training centers. Healthcare services are comprehensive, with several major hospitals and clinics offering a range of medical care. The city's public library system is extensive, providing residents with access to a wealth of resources. Retail and dining experiences are abundant, showcasing everything from high-end boutiques to local eateries that offer a taste of the region's culinary diversity.

Atlanta is celebrated for its vibrant culture and rich history, priding itself on being a hub of arts, entertainment, and innovation. The community's character is shaped by its numerous festivals, including the famous Atlanta Dogwood Festival and the Atlanta Jazz Festival, which reflect the city's diverse cultural tapestry and creative spirit. The area's green spaces, like Piedmont Park, contribute to the city's lively yet relaxed atmosphere.

Atlanta's housing market is diverse, offering a mix of high-rise apartments, traditional single-family homes, and contemporary townhouses. The city's skyline is dotted with modern condominiums, while historic neighborhoods preserve Victorian and Craftsman bungalows. The housing landscape is predominantly composed of single-family homes, which make up a significant portion of the market. Apartments and townhouses are also available, particularly in more urbanized districts, catering to a range of preferences and lifestyles.

Atlanta, GA housing market in June 2025 saw over 252 listings sold above listed price, more than 241 sold at listed price and over 718 sold below. The number of listings in Atlanta, GA increased by 10.2% between May and June 2025. In June 2025, listings were on the market for 45 days. During the same period, the median list price in this real estate market was $426,329.
